About Francis S Gabreski Airport
Francis S. Gabreski Airport is a county-owned, joint civil-military airport located 3 nautical miles (6 km) north of the central business district of Westhampton Beach, in Suffolk County, New York, United States. It is approximately 80 miles (130 km) east of New York City, on Long Island.

Runways (3)
| Runway | Length | Width | Surface | Lighting |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 06 / 24 | 9,002 ft / 2,744 m | 150 ft | Pem | Lighted | Open |
| 01 / 19 | 5,100 ft / 1,554 m | 150 ft | Pem | Unlit | Open |
| 15 / 33 | 5,002 ft / 1,525 m | 150 ft | Asp | Lighted | Open |
Radio frequencies (7)
| Type | Description | Frequency |
|---|---|---|
| A/D | NEW YORK APP/DEP | 118.950 MHz |
| ASOS | ASOS | 119.925 MHz |
| CTAF | CTAF | 125.300 MHz |
| GND | GND | 121.800 MHz |
| OPS | ANG OPS | 28.750 MHz |
| TWR | TWR | 125.300 MHz |
| UNIC | UNICOM | 122.950 MHz |

What is the ICAO code for Francis S Gabreski Airport?
The ICAO code for Francis S Gabreski Airport is KFOK, and its IATA code is FOK.
Where is Francis S Gabreski Airport located?
Francis S Gabreski Airport is small airport located in Westhampton Beach, United States, at an elevation of 67 ft (20 m).
How many runways does Francis S Gabreski Airport have?
Francis S Gabreski Airport has 3 runways, the longest being 9,002 ft / 2,744 m.
What time zone is Francis S Gabreski Airport in?
Francis S Gabreski Airport is in the America/New York time zone (UTC-04:00).
What is the magnetic variation at Francis S Gabreski Airport?
The magnetic variation (declination) at Francis S Gabreski Airport is approximately 13.1° W, per the World Magnetic Model. Variation changes slowly over time — always use the current value charted for navigation.
What airports are near Francis S Gabreski Airport?
The nearest airport to Francis S Gabreski Airport is Spadaro Airport (1N2), about 5.4 nm to the w, followed by Lufker Airport and Talmage Field.
